  • Cannot add the ESX 6.0 host to vCenter Server 6.0

    OK, I'm testing laboratory a vsan 6.0 cluster.

    I have my running 6.0.0 esx hosts and vcenter server is 6.0.0 also.

    I have the services platform on a virtual machine and vcenter on another. I was able to create a data center, then a cluster below.

    Then I went to try to add a host to my group and I get this error...

    Failed to contact the specified host (hostname\IP). The host may not be available on the network, may have a network configuration problem, or that the management on this host services may not respond.


    Per this KB: KB VMware: Add a host VMware ESXi/ESX from VMware vCenter Server fails


    I confirmed that my vcenter server and platform services server can see all esx hosts. From the vcenter server, it can ping the host esx and PuTTY can access all of them. I even installed the client and it can connect to all esx hosts. I used the netbios name, IP and FULL domain name and they all work.

    I have only a single subnet, so this isn't a problem. DNS resolution works in all areas of both sides, vcenter esx hosts and host esx to vcenter.


    I am quite puzzled.



    OK, after working with VMware on this issue, I think that I thought about it.

    All my hosts are DL360 G6 servers.

    My hosts are run the same build «VMware-ESXi-6.0.0-2494585-HP-600.9.2.38-Mar2015.iso» ESX Downloaded from HP.

    All buildings are in trial mode.

    After placing a call to VMware, they had me build some ESX VM, the services of the platform and the vcenter VM on an ESX host. We suspended because it took all day to go upward.

    Once I woke up all the parts (sql server, esx vm, server platform & vcenter) in virtualization nested, I created my data center, then Cluster then added the ESX host.

    The hosts added properly, no error. Then I remembered when I installed ESX inside a virtual machine, I am angry that the iso, I had the habit of HP does not work in my VM nested due to virtualized hardware.

    Then a fire came into my head. We will rebuild all of the physical cluster but NOT use the CV provided the iso file but use VMware provided iso file "VMware-VMvisor-Installer - 6.0.0 - 2159203.x86_64.iso".

    I did it today. I have rebuilt all hosts with the provided iso file VMware ESX...

    Spun SQL Server vCenter, service platform, all VM VM VM you need. My AD & DNS VM are on another server, so he has been upwards all the time.

    Connected to the web interface (yuck!).

    Created my data center...

    Created my Cluster...

    Add all my Cluster hosts.

    All of this worked!

    Therefore, if you encounter the same problem, I'm plan to generate your with the provided iso file VMware ESX hosts and try it. In my case, the provided HP iso file didn't work properly for me.

    I also downloaded the iso file of HP 2 other times to make sure and do a validation test and it did the same thing.

  • Help with a conversion from an ESX 4.0 host ESXi4.1

    Hi all

    I'm new to VMware. I was given a task to virtualize infrastructure. I bought 3 dell 610's with 64 GB of ram and an equallogic SAN 6000. I have all three new hosts and the SAN in collaboration with a few virtual machines running in it as it is. I have the advanced VMware license. I also have VMCenter installed and working.

    What I need help on is the following:

    I have a computer host running ESX 4.0 with a local storage with exchange 2003 and windows 2008 r2 server x 64 running on it. How can I move the two virtual machines to the SAN, and then upgrade to the host ESX to ESXi 4.1?

    Kind regards

    CG

    Hello

    As Scott says, you simply add the host in vCenter Server and connect the ESX to the San.  Then you can migrate your VMS (virtual machines must be turned off) from the existing to the new host.

    If for some reason you cannot connect the host to the SAN, then you can try with vCenter Converter to do a V2V conversion to migrate your virtual machines.

    Finally, there is no way to upgrade from ESX to ESXi, so you need to do a clean install of ESXi on your existing host.

  • Upgrading memory on ESX 3.5 hosts

    Hi all

    We are trying to upgrade the memory of our esx 3.5 hosts.  If we properly close the guests, then we properly stop the host, will be the guests of vmotion.  According to me, they won't, but I was curious to know if it is happen.

    If the guests are turned off, then stop you hosts, there is no HA/DRS.  All guests will stay in an engine out of State until the ESX host come back online.

    If you have vCenter with vMotion/DRS, you can do a rolling upgrade.  vMotion all guests to another host in the cluster, put vacuum host in maintenance mode, it off, add RAM, if power return, exit maintenance mode.  Rinse and repeat.
